M.DURAISWAMY, J.
The learned Administrator General and Official Trustee has filed the above
application seeking permission to donate Rs.2,00,000/- (Rupees Two Lakhs Only)
from the accumulation funds of financial year 2016-17 of the Trust Estate of ''Salem
Sambandham Pillai'' to Sri Sarada Math, No.15/7, Raghaviah Road, Chennai - 600
017 for its service to the needy women and children.
2. In support of the judge's summon, the learned Administrator General and
Official Trustee has filed a report dated 14.03.2022, which reads as follows:
